Comments (3)
This test case draws in platform dependent dependency ( org.eclipse.swt.gtk.linux.x86_64_3.3.0.v3346.jar) which might not be working if run on other platforms such as Windows.
from p2-maven-plugin.
Hi,
I am happy you like it ;)
The config looks fine. There's a bug that the plugin does not work with maven 3.1.x.
Could you try with 3.0.x?
Tom Bujok
Reficio™ - Reestablish your software!
http://www.reficio.org
On Wednesday, October 9, 2013 at 12:03 AM, sstlaurent wrote:
Hi,
First, thank you for this great project.
Second,
I tried the quickstart pom that i modified to fit my needs. I all went fine on my local computer. But it fail if i run it inside bamboo on another computer. It maybe my maven version or something else.
Fai
Caused by: org.apache.maven.plugin.PluginConfigurationException: Unable to parse configuration of mojo org.reficio:p2-maven-plugin:1.0.3-SNAPSHOT:site: Error loading class 'org.reficio.p2.Artifact'
Caused by: org.codehaus.plexus.component.configurator.ComponentConfigurationException: Error loading class 'org.reficio.p2.Artifact'
Caused by: java.lang.ClassNotFoundException: org.reficio.p2.Artifact
with this configuration
org.reficio p2-maven-plugin 1.0.3-SNAPSHOT default-cli ca.infodata:util1.restful:1.0.0 ca.infodata:util1.common:1.0.0 ca.infodata:util1.group:1.0.0 ca.infodata:util1.encryption:1.0.0 ca.infodata:apple.finder.search:1.0.0 ca.infodata:ofys.data.middle.dataobjects_client:0.0.1-SNAPSHOT com.sun.jersey:jersey-client:1.17.1 true net.java.dev.jna:jna:3.3.0 net.java.dev.jna:jna::platform:3.3.0 org.mb.listeners:listeners:1.0.0 ca.infodata:stats2.minimalog.client:1.0.0 jfree:jfreechart:1.0.13 jfree:jfreechart-swt:1.0.9 org.glassfish:javax.jms:3.1.1 com.miglayout:miglayout-swt:4.2 commons-collections:commons-collections:3.2.1 commons-codec:commons-codec:1.6 commons-io:commons-io:2.3 commons-lang:commons-lang:2.5 org.apache.commons:commons-lang3:3.1 ca.infodata:readhl7:1.0.0 com.google.code.gson:gson:2.2.4 javassist:javassist:3.12.1.GA org.bouncycastle:bcmail-jdk16:1.46 org.bouncycastle:bcprov-jdk16:1.46 log4j:log4j:1.2.17 org.swinglabs:pdf-renderer:1.0.5 com.googlecode.jatl:jatl:0.2.2 xmlrpc:xmlrpc:2.0.1 com.lowagie:itext:2.1.7 org.apache.pdfbox:pdfbox:1.8.2
Is this configuration ok ?
Is the problem elsewhere ?
Is is a bug ?—
Reply to this email directly or view it on GitHub (#39).
from p2-maven-plugin.
I added a test case with your config (I had to comment out your internal artifacts) and everything works like a charm.
Maybe you used Maven 2.x?
Anyway, here's the test case:
https://github.com/reficio/p2-maven-plugin/blob/master/src/it/bug-39-parse-error-it/pom.xml
I am closing the issue. If you can still reproduce it, plz, let me know.
from p2-maven-plugin.
Related Issues (20)
- [BUG] Embebbed BND Tool ends with errors but build is sucessfull HOT 1
- Support for Multi-release JAR
- create binary identical JARs for unmodified input HOT 1
- [ENH] Sanitize broken manifest in source bundles HOT 7
- Allow exclude at root level HOT 2
- Move from Github Action to Drone
- Publish Maven Site as Gihub Page
- Automate Writing Release Notes
- [Maintenance] Maven Build fails when running with Maven 3.8.1 HOT 2
- Mapping javadoc attachment
- Documentation request: Cutting a recursion
- Dependency Dashboard
- API Incopatibility when using the plugin with tycho version > 1.3.0 HOT 5
- Is there a way to sign the jars before creating the artifacts.jar? HOT 6
- Making a local site that _mimic_ a `.target` results in `ZipException: zip END header not found` HOT 2
- Support using maven BOMs to specify library versions HOT 1
- Update JUnit Tests to JUnit 5 HOT 1
- Tycho 3.0.0 incompatibilities HOT 19
- How to exclude certain file while generating a bundle from jar? HOT 3
- Option to remove osgi.ee capability requirements HOT 1
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from p2-maven-plugin.